Abstract

We report a simple technique for the reconstruction of lower eyelid using paired horizontal advancement flaps. It is suitable for defects upto 2 cm squared and not involving the eyelid margin. The technique has been performed on 21 patients over four years with excellent cosmetic results. The methods and results are described.
